A fundamental breach has been defined as one which destroys "the whole contractual substratum, "as undermining the whole contract, as involving a totally different performance of the contract from that intended by the parties, as involving an event which deprives the innocent party of substantially the whole benefit which that party was to obtain under the contract.

Although the expression "repudiation" is usually employed to describe an express or implied refusal on the part of a promisor to perform his contractual obligations, the expression "repudiatory breach" has recently been employed to describe any breach capable of giving rise to a right to terminate at common law. The expression encompasses both breach of condition and... "fundamental breach"....

A breach of contract, no matter what form it may take, always entitles the innocent party to maintain an action for damages, but the rule established by a long line of authorities is that the right of a party to treat a contract as discharged arises only in two types of case. Firstly, where the party in default has repudiated the contract before performance is due or before it has been fully performed. Secondly, where the party in default has committed what in modern judicial parlance is called a fundamental breach.
